Cosmic Being F Move requirements
| Requirement | Details | Fastest Method |
|---|---|---|
| Cosmic Being Boss | Defeat 15 times | Server hop + team up |
| Infinite Tower | Reach Floor 91 (5 times) | Run with a squad |
| Astral Bloodline | Obtain via Bloodline Stone | Farm or trade efficiently |
| Final Reward | F Move +30% damage | Unlocks automatically |
Cosmic Being F Move unlock explained
Finding Cosmic Being at Sea 2 (Punch Island)
Before diving into the grind, make sure you already have the Cosmic Being fighting style unlocked, as it is a strict prerequisite.

Without it, none of the progression counts. Once ready, head over to Sea 2 – Punch Island, where you’ll find the Cosmic Being Master NPC, who essentially acts as your progression checkpoint.

It’s worth preparing a strong loadout and possibly gathering a team beforehand, because every requirement favors efficiency through cooperation rather than solo play.
Requirement 1: Defeat Cosmic Being 15 times
Travel to Punch Island in Sea 2 and locate the Cosmic Being Boss spawn. The boss appears every 30 minutes, which is the biggest bottleneck if approached passively.

Fight alongside other players. The boss has high HP, so teaming up ensures faster kills and reduces the risk of failure. Repeat until you reach 15 total defeats. Keep track of your progress, as consistency is key here.
The combination of server hopping and group combat is the most efficient strategy, allowing you to complete this requirement far quicker than intended pacing.
Requirement 2: Reach Floor 90+ in Infinite Tower 5 times

Head to Tower Island in Sea 1 and enter the Infinite Tower mode. This is a separate challenge focused on endurance. Push through enemies until you reach Floor 91. This is the required milestone per run.

Complete this process five times. Each run counts individually, so consistency matters. Form a team to speed up each run. With multiple players, clearing waves becomes significantly faster and safer.
Requirement 3: Equip Astral Bloodline

Acquire a Bloodline Stone through farming, trading, or events. This is the key item needed for unlocking. Use the Bloodline Stone and roll for the Astral Bloodline. RNG plays a role here, so patience may be required.

Once all three requirements are completed, the Cosmic Being F Move unlocks automatically!
Rewards of the Cosmic Being F Move

What stands out in this unlock process is how much it rewards smart play over raw time investment. Server hopping eliminates downtime, while team-based farming multiplies your efficiency across every requirement. If you try to complete everything solo and passively, the grind can feel unnecessarily long.
| Reward | Effect |
|---|---|
| Cosmic Being F Move | Unlocks automatically after requirements |
| Damage Boost | +30% increased damage |
| Combat Advantage | Stronger PvE and boss efficiency |
Once all requirements are complete, the move unlocks automatically without needing additional interaction, making it a satisfying payoff for your effort.
